The Illinois primary election has highlighted the growing pressure on Democratic governors across the United States regarding President Donald Trump’s federal school choice program. This controversial initiative has sparked debate among party members about its implications for public education. The outcomes of these primaries may influence future support for school choice initiatives at both state and federal levels.
